Verdict
The market can be the only real guide to how this field of newcomers are going to perform but Malcolm Jefferson has a better than one in three strike-rate with his bumper horses at the track so it's probably safe to assume that TEMPLE MAN will know what's required. He's a half-brother to two winning jumpers so gets the nod, though his long-term future will be over fences. The filly Tokaramore, also by Sulamani, who is a half-sister to a winning jumper and Thomas Todd also makes some appeal on pedigree.
